Output ebefee3923075495f27ea0e9f645208ffc2c91ed2c1888957dad4ff22ed04043:0

value
267528268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 164dc437d7707965875334bd0a18015a91373c63 OP_EQUAL
address
33iwx5DmKyZnLr9xPEATsPFt3Jq4Mhfo6G
transaction
ebefee3923075495f27ea0e9f645208ffc2c91ed2c1888957dad4ff22ed04043
confirmations
341169
spent
true